Universe  ID: 13988

The Webb Telescope Installed to the Rollover Fixture Time-Lapses

Time-lapse footage of engineers lifting and installing the Webb Telescope onto the rollover fixture at Northrop Grumman in Redondo Beach, CA.

Credits

Aaron E. Lepsch (ADNET Systems, Inc.): Technical Support
Michael McClare (KBR Wyle Services, LLC): Producer
Michael McClare (KBR Wyle Services, LLC): Lead Videographer
Sophia Roberts (Advocates in Manpower Management, Inc.): Videographer
Michael P. Menzel (Advocates in Manpower Management, Inc.): Videographer
Michael P. Menzel (Advocates in Manpower Management, Inc.): Video Editor
Please give credit for this item to:
NASA's Goddard Space Flight Center